ILLINOIS. 

Smallpox at Westfield.  —It is reported that smallpox is prevalent in Westfield to such an extent that the public schools have been closed.

Must Report Births.  —Section 2 of the new law provides that "every physician, midwife, parent, or householder shall be paid for each report of birth made in the manner directed by the State Board of Health the sum of 25 cents." The law is mandatory and for its violation a penalty of a fine varying from $10 to $100 is provided.
